JAMAICA-ENERGY-Cuba to provide expertise in local manufacture of solar panels

Jul 08, 2013

KINGSTON, Jamaica, CMC- Jamaica will partner with Cuba to facilitate the local manufacture and assembly of cost effective solar light panels.
This undertaking forms part of the administration’s move towards incorporating renewable alternatives into the local energy mix in order to reduce the country’s huge energy bill.
Energy Minister, Phillip Paulwell, who made the disclosure during the ceremonial switching on of lights in the communities of New Forest and Plumwood in the central parish of Manchester last week said that the Rural Electrification Programme (REP) Limited will guide the process.
